English: Rickreall Creek in Rickreall, Polk County, Oregon, where it is crossed by Oregon Route 99W. Note the old bridge abutment. Per Rickreall Junction Transportation Facility Plan: "Oregon 99W was constructed through the community of Rickreall in the early 1920s following an existing road. A covered bridge was originally constructed over Rickreall Creek in the 1910s, but was replaced by a concrete slab bridge in 1923. That bridge was replaced in 1960."
